Michael K. Demetrio, a partner at the Chicago personal injury law firm of Corboy & Demetrio, represents individuals in
personal injury and wrongful death cases, including product liability, construction liability and motor vehicle liability.
His principle focus is the preparation and trial of aviation and all forms of transportation cases. Prior to becoming a
successful and accomplished Chicago personal injury lawyer, he was a criminal prosecutor at the Cook County State’s
Attorney’s Office. During his career, he has tried over 100 cases to verdict.
Mr. Demetrio has prosecuted numerous aviation and train disaster cases across the United States. Among them is the crash of
a US Airway’s jet where he settled the final case in that crash for $25.2 million, a commercial aviation record. Michael was
the court-appointed Lead Counsel for the Plaintiffs’ Steering Committee in the Multi-District Federal litigation stemming
from the crash of American Eagle Flight #3379 near Morrisville, North Carolina. He was also appointed plaintiffs' Lead
Counsel by the Chief Judge of the Cook County Circuit Court for the over 60 cases arising from the crash of an Amtrak train
in Bourbonnais, Illinois. Mr. Demetrio also handles all aspects of appellate cases before the Illinois Appellate and Supreme
Courts.
